What is the simplified expression for the expression below?
-1(2x + 3) – 2(x - 1)

Answer:

-4x - 1

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ex]-1(2x+3)-2(x-1)\qquad\text{use the distributive property}\\\\=(-1)(2x)+(-1)(3)+(-2)(x)+(-2)(-1)\\\\=-2x-3-2x+2\qquad\text{combine like terms}\\\\=(-2x-2x)+(-3+2)\\\\=-4x-1[/tex]
